pub struct WebBranch {
pub name: Option<String>,
pub commit: Option<Value>,
pub is_protected: Option<bool>,
}
Expand description
WebBranch 模型
Fields§
§name: Option<String>
§commit: Option<Value>
§is_protected: Option<bool>
Trait Implementations§
Source§impl<'de> Deserialize<'de> for WebBranch
impl<'de> Deserialize<'de> for WebBranch
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for WebBranch
impl RefUnwindSafe for WebBranch
impl Send for WebBranch
impl Sync for WebBranch
impl Unpin for WebBranch
impl UnwindSafe for WebBranch
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more